COW-TESTING FIGURES.

THAMES VALLEY EXPERIENCE. A report prepared by Mr. W. J. Byrne, testing officer for the Thames Valley Dairy Co., makes interesting reading for the dairyman. . The report says: .' . "The season has been an exceptionally good one from a dairying point of view, •and it can safely be contended that the cows were in a favourable position to. do their best. During the season 2078 cows were tested, and the various creamery districts were represented .in number of cows-as follows:—Netherton, 671. cows; Matatahi, 315; Hikutaia, 273; Paeroa, 267; Wharepoa, 167; Waitoa, 145; Turura, 95; Komata, 75; .Manawaru, 32; total, 2078. . The following summary will show the vast difference, in producing power of some of the cows and herds:— , , ■ ' Butter-fat. .-'■■. ■ .' lb. Average association cow 242.45 The best herd averaged 308.79 The worst herd averaged 10G.58 The best 20 herds averaged 251.67 The worst 20 herds averaged 181.88 The best cow gave 547.36 Tils worst cow gave : 40.89 The 10 best cows averaged 437.12 The 10 worst cows averaged ......... 80.81 "There verc 11 herds above the average of the whole association. There were over 50 herds below the average association cow. ■..■''. "Thetcost of testing, including the testing outfit-to members, worked out at 2s. 7d. per cow, or 9d. per cow, for the outfit, and Is. ldd. for the testing work. Two shillings and ninepenceis a sa'fe basis to work from in an association of 2000.c0w5."
